When I walk my dogs, I prefer them to be in a harness for their comfort and safety. I make sure to watch the dogs closely, so if I see any signs of stress, I will promptly remove them from the situation. During the summer months especially, I will make sure to walk them early in the morning or in well shaded areas to make sure their paws are well protected from the hot pavement. I carry a dog water bottle with me on my walks, so they always have access to clean water if needed. When dog sitting, I take them out constantly, offer lots of playtime and stimulation while there, and always make sure the area is clean.

House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Bishop on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$40 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.
As of Aug 2025, there are 389 house sitters in Bishop.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 85% of Bishop house sitters respond in under an hour.
House sitters in Bishop have an average of 16 years of experience. House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ients.
